th 252 - Troubleshooting Linux Command-Line Call Issues in Os.System

Troubleshooting Linux Command-Line Call Issues in Os.System

Posted on
th?q=Linux Command Line Call Not Returning What It Should From Os - Troubleshooting Linux Command-Line Call Issues in Os.System

As a Linux user, you might have encountered call issues in the command-line. It can be frustrating when your calls are not being executed as expected. But don’t worry, this article will guide you through troubleshooting these issues in the OS system.

One of the most common call issues is incorrect syntax. A simple typo or deviation from the accepted syntax can cause a command to fail completely. You might want to double-check your spelling, spaces, and special characters before pressing enter. This article will provide tips on how to identify and fix syntax errors for successful commands.

Another call issue that can arise is permission problems. Certain commands may require administrative privileges to be executed. If you are facing permission issues, this article will show you how to use the sudo command to gain access to higher privileges and carry out your desired task.

In summary, if you are experiencing call issues in the Linux command-line, this article is a must-read. It covers the most common problems encountered while working with the OS system and provides practical solutions to help you overcome them. By the end of this article, you will have gained valuable insights on how to troubleshoot call issues and optimize your work in the Linux environment.

th?q=Linux%20Command Line%20Call%20Not%20Returning%20What%20It%20Should%20From%20Os - Troubleshooting Linux Command-Line Call Issues in Os.System
“Linux Command-Line Call Not Returning What It Should From Os.System?” ~ bbaz

Troubleshooting Linux Command-Line Call Issues in Os.System

Linux is a free and open-source operating system with diverse functionalities. It is commonly used in servers, data centers, and handheld devices due to its flexibility and versatility. One of the core features of Linux is its command-line interface (CLI), which allows users to interact with the system using text-based commands. However, sometimes issues can arise when calling and executing Linux command-line calls in Os.System. This article will explore how to troubleshoot such issues to ensure a seamless user experience.

Understanding Common Linux Command-Line Call Issues

Before learning how to troubleshoot Linux command-line call issues, it’s crucial to understand the most common problems users encounter when utilizing this feature on an Os.System. These issues include incorrect syntax or parameters, unresponsive shells, corrupted binaries, improperly installed packages, and permission errors. Knowing these chief problems will assist in narrowing down root causes and identifying potential solutions.

Utilizing the which Command

If you encounter a command not found error when looking for a specific command, the which command can help locate where it is installed on your system. The which command functions by displaying the absolute path for a given command. For example, given the command which python, the output should display /usr/bin/python. In this way, executing the command using the absolute path instead of a relative path can allow the system to locate it without issue.

Identifying Incorrect Syntax

A common issue when utilizing Linux command-line calls is incorrect syntax. If your command fails to execute, double-check to ensure that the command syntax and parameters are accurate. Researching the proper syntax and reviewing documentation may help identify errors. Additionally, utilizing the man command will provide detailed information regarding the proper syntax of your command.

Troubleshooting Unresponsive Shells

At times, users may experience an unresponsive shell when executing commands or inputting text. This issue typically arises when there is a hung process in the system. To identify this, one can execute the ps -ef command to display all running processes. If a process is shown in a state other than running, it may be responsible for preventing further execution. Using the kill command with the appropriate process ID should stop the process and allow the terminal window prompt to become responsive again.

Solving Corrupted Binaries

The inability to execute a Linux command-line call may result from corrupted binaries or missing files. Executing the ldd command on the binary will display shared object dependencies that may be missing or require updating. Installing these dependencies or reinstalling the relevant package can solve the issue.

Fixing Improper Package Installation

Improperly installed packages or missing dependencies may also cause issues with Linux command-line calls. Utilizing the package manager, such as the apt-get or yum command, can help to identify the faulty package or install the missing dependencies automatically. Properly installing or reinstalling the package can sometimes result in successful execution of the command.

Addressing Permission Errors

Permission errors may also arise when attempting to execute Linux command-line calls. Users may encounter errors such as permission denied or operation not permitted while attempting to execute a command. This issue may resolve by utilizing the sudo command to execute the command with root privileges. Although, it is essential to be cautious while executing commands with elevated privileges, and ensure that you are only executing commands from trusted sources.

Embracing Troubleshooting Resources

Although understanding how to troubleshoot Linux command-line call issues is essential, it’s essential to know of available resources when things go wrong. The most common and helpful resources include the online community, official documentation, and Linux forums. These communities may offer insight into the errors users face and support in identifying solutions.

Creating a Comparison Table

Issue Solution
Command not found Use which command to locate where the command is installed on your system.
Incorrect syntax or parameters Research proper syntax and parameters or utilize the man command for further details.
Unresponsive shells Identify hung process with ps -ef command and execute kill command with the appropriate process ID.
Corrupted binaries and missing files Execute the ldd command on the binary to display shared object dependencies that may require updating or installing.
Improper package installation or missing dependencies Utilize package manager to identify the faulty package, missing dependencies and install or reinstall properly.
Permission errors Execute command with root privileges by using sudo command with caution.

Opinion

Troubleshooting Linux command-line call issues may seem daunting at first, but with the correct approach and knowledge, identifying solutions can become second nature. Using resources such as online communities, official documentation, and forums can greatly assist in resolving errors efficiently. Additionally, embracing the tools mentioned in this article, such as the which and kill commands, can further streamline the troubleshooting process. Ultimately, understanding how to troubleshoot Linux command-line call issues will result in a more seamless and improved user experience.

Thank you for taking the time to read this article on troubleshooting Linux command-line call issues in your OS system. We hope that the tips and solutions provided have been useful and have helped you fix any issues you may have been experiencing.

Remember, it is important to always approach any technical issue with a clear and level head. While it may be frustrating to encounter problems with your system, there are always solutions available – it just takes some patience and perseverance to find them.

If you continue to experience issues or have any questions about the troubleshooting process, don’t hesitate to reach out to a professional for assistance. There is no shame in asking for help, and in fact, it can often lead to a quicker and more efficient solution.

Again, we appreciate your readership and hope that this article has provided you with valuable insight into maintaining and troubleshooting your Linux OS system.

People Also Ask about Troubleshooting Linux Command-Line Call Issues in Os.System

  1. What are the common call issues when using Linux command-line?
  2. The common call issues when using Linux command-line are incorrect syntax or parameters, wrong path, insufficient permissions, and network connectivity problems.

  3. How do I know if a command-line call is not working?
  4. If a command-line call is not working, you may receive an error message or the system may not respond at all. You can also check the exit status code of the command by typing echo $? after running it. A non-zero value indicates an error.

  5. What should I do if a command-line call is not working?
  6. If a command-line call is not working, you can try to troubleshoot by checking the syntax and parameters, verifying the path and permissions, and testing the network connectivity. You can also search for solutions online or consult the documentation of the tool or application you are using.

  7. How can I debug a command-line call in Linux?
  8. You can debug a command-line call in Linux by using tools like strace, ltrace, gdb, or valgrind, which allow you to trace system calls, library functions, and memory usage. You can also use logging or debugging options provided by some applications or scripts.

  9. What are some tips for avoiding call issues in Linux command-line?
  10. To avoid call issues in Linux command-line, you can follow these tips:

  • Double-check the syntax and parameters before running a command.
  • Use tab completion or history to avoid typos and save time.
  • Use relative paths or variables instead of absolute paths to make your commands more portable.
  • Set appropriate permissions for files and directories to avoid permission denied errors.
  • Test your commands on a small scale before running them on a large scale.